to reach your goals.EisnerAmper is seeking an Experienced Staff to
join our Tax Technology team. We are seeking an energetic,
self-motivated, and solution-focused individual who can liaise with
business stakeholders and technology teams to enable complete
understanding of business requirements allowing for more effective
testing and implementation of technology solutions.What it Means to

Belonging effortsWhat Work You Will be Responsible For:
- Assist in the planning, design, documentation and execution of
testing practices to validate solutions to meet the Tax Department
functional needs.
- Serve as a liaison between the tax teams, development team, and
end-users to ensure alignment of technical solutions with business
needs.
- Collect, analyze, and interpret data from various sources to
identify trends, patterns, and correlations, then translating those
insights into actionable reports and dashboards.
- Identify opportunities for tax process improvements and
optimization based on data insights
- Provide quick and effective assistance to tax team regarding
systems configuration, troubleshooting, and maintenance.
- Contribute to thoughtful and creative discussions with internal
stakeholders and department leadership.Basic Qualifications:
- BS in Accounting, Business Management, Computer Science, or
equivalent.
- 1+ years experience in developing data-driven technology
solutions
- Experience with Microsoft 365, Azure, workflow tools (e.g.,
Alteryx), and data visualizations and analytics (e.g., Power
BI)
- Experience with Microsoft Office and Adobe
SuitePreferred/Desired Qualifications:
- Exposure to tax technology and processes, including tax
compliance and software testing.
- Exposure to tax applications such Wolters Kluwer CCH Axcess and
Thomson Reuters GoSystem, and intermediate skills with Excel.
